The Blockchain Connect Conference, set to attract blockchain professionals and enthusiasts from around the globe in January, will be the largest team-up to date between the two powerhouses in the fast-moving blockchain space: China and the U.S.

SAN FRANCISCO, Dec. 11, 2017 — Blockchain Connect Conference will be held at the Palace of Fine Arts on January 26, 2018 in San Francisco. This conference will attract more than 1,000 blockchain practitioners worldwide. Well-known blockchain scientists, entrepreneurs, investors, developers and industry stakeholders from China, Japan, Singapore, and the U.S. to discuss the technological innovations, market dynamics, and development direction in the blockchain industry.

SV Insight will be hosting the conference, together with Draper Dragon, DHVC, Consensys, Bodhi, and BeeChat. SV Insight is a top-tier technology media company in the United States targeting Mandarin-speaking people. Draper Dragon is a cross-border high-tech investment fund between China and the United States. DHVC is one of the largest venture capital firms in the Silicon Valley. Consensys is a global blockchain giant, and the founder of Consensys, Joseph Lubin, is also a co-founder of Ethereum.

Prominent guests at this conference will include Tim Draper, a Silicon Valley legend investor who invested in companies such as Skype, Tesla, and SpaceX; Brad Garlinghouse, the CEO of Ripple; the world’s top five digital assets; Charlie Lee, the creator of Litecoin; Joseph Poon, co-author of the Lightning Network White Paper and Plasma, and other blockchain experts. More experts are waiting for the arrival of their invitations.

The theme of this conference is “Blockchain Technology Evolution in United States and China”. The keynote speech will focus on the growth of the blockchain in technology, commerce, and investment between China and the United States. Speakers will discuss topics on the forefront of the industry, including hard-fork and IFO, enterprise blockchain solutions, secrets of token exchanges and other topics. Specific topics include Building A Country Powered by Blockchain Technology; New Scaling Solutions for Blockchain; How to Build a Blockchain App with 1 Million Users in 2 Months; VC vs. ICO Funds: Token Valuation and Exit Strategy; What We Have Discovered from Over 10,000 White Papers, and more.

The conference aims to set up an open and professional exchange and cooperation platform for all participants, so all the investors, project partners, infrastructure providers, and professionals can have an excellent opportunity to connect with each other. There will be keynotes, panels, fireside chats, a VIP dinner, and other networking sessions at the conference. Thirty blockchain companies will be hosting exhibition booths and recruiting top talent.
